SHAKESPEARE, WILLIAM. 1564-1616.

The Works. Edited by Howard Staunton. London: George Routledge & Sons, 1881.
15 volumes in 40. Mounted frontispiece and numerous illustrations by John Gilbert. 20th century three-quarter calf and marbled boards, morocco gilt lettering pieces.

LIMITED EDITION, number 819 of 1,000 copies of the De Luxe edition.
